I have always had Thinkpad stuff for the last 8 years. I always wanted a fast laptop, not neccessarily for gaming, but just general speed. I bought the wife a G72 laptop to replace her Thinkpad T60 a month ago. It is a really nice laptop, and i liked it so much i bought a G60-RX009 laptop a few days ago for myself. (The 009 version has upgraded cpu, battery, and hard disk.) The only drawback to the Asus laptops is no docking station capability. I have my main gaming PC for real action, but i might try some games on this laptop also.

Anyways.. i def recommend the asus laptop.
